carpet wise I guess the question is whether you want to go for originality or looks.

Originally would have had boucle carpet (same as 356s, Mercs of the period) along with rubber mats for floor and central tunnel.

Southbound did the carpet set for my 912 which wasn't ridiculously priced but then there wasn't much to it really as I kept the rubber mats.
